A lively run-through of the major Oscar contenders, from Best Picture matchups to director and acting races. Hot takes on frontrunners and surprise possibilities keep the predictions tense. The conversation wraps with quick picks for what’s bringing the panel joy this week in music and film.

Factor Campaigning And Career Moments For Acting Predictions

  • For Acting races, combine campaign energy, showiness, and perceived career moments when predicting winners.
  • Aisha and Glen cite Timothée Chalamet's aggressive campaign and Michael B. Jordan's twin-role craft as deciding factors.
INSIGHT

Jesse Buckley Has The Momentum In Best Actress

  • Jesse Buckley is positioned as the likely Best Actress winner because her performance in Hamnet is both showy and cumulative of a strong body of work.
  • Panel notes her mix of quiet, spiky, and all-out acting in the film's final minutes.
INSIGHT

Sustained Close Framing Powers A Heavy Best Actress Case

  • Rose Byrne's If I Had Legs I'd Kick You is the panel's 'should' winner for Best Actress due to relentless close-ups and visceral emotional work.
  • Hosts emphasize the difficulty of sustaining empathy while keeping the camera tight on one exhausted character.
